The Supreme Court Exposes More IRS Abusive Powers 16.06.2023

A recent unanimous Supreme Court ruling should alarm all Americans. The court ruled that if a friend or co-worker of yours owes money to the IRS, the IRS can look at your bank account information without your knowledge even if there is no legal connection between you and the person the IRS is targeting for collection. Rent Seeking 12.05.2023

Rent seeking is an economic concept that's been around since the 18th century. It explains why DC has been so resistant to replacing the income/payroll tax system with the FAIRtax. Today, rent seeking involves obtaining economic wealth or opportunity from government payments without exchanging anything of value. Another Unnecessary Burden 06.01.2023

In order to catch an admittedly small number of tax cheats, the IRS is going to impose draconian reporting requirements on all of us who receive payments through online payment services like PayPal and Venmo.
